You get what you pay for – It’s a cheap system, so you get a cheap system. Decent video quality. You can’t get the video or pictures that are recorded, off of the recorder. The software suggests that you can export the video or images, but you can’t. There is only one USB port, and it only recognizes a mouse. It doesn’t recognize thumb/flash drives. If you want to provide video or pictures to the police, you have to give them the unit, or the hard drive. The images are small, and you can’t magnify. The video play back is decent, but you also can’t magnify. You can zoom with the cameras, but it’s not a true zoom. The more you zoom the worse the image quality gets. I sent a support request to Zosi. It’s been 10 days without their support contacting me. Setup was not difficult. It was easier than I anticipated. The owners’ manual doesn’t cover much. There isn’t any how to instruction, for using the system. I can’t figure out what half of the stuff in the menu do.

Well worth the money. – To be frank, people being unhappy with this product are being ridiculous. You just paid for a 4 (can be 8) camera system that has either 24/7, scheduled, or motion detection recording and spent, what, $109 bucks. Not so long ago this system would’ve cost you thousands. I gave 4 stars because, yes, it’s not perfect. The motion detection isn’t very sensitive. Yes, the cameras are plastic, not aluminum. But if you have WiFi you can get the app and check your house at any time. The cameras ARE weatherproof but being that they are plastic it’s better to have them under a porch roof. Yes the system isn’t perfect, but for the cost, way worth what you spend. If you want perfection, you’re gonna pay for it regardless of what company you go with. All the mild issues with this system really aren’t worth paying hundreds of more dollars for. Everyone be safe out there.

Buy the spider cable – The set comes with one power supply for four cameras. You will need the spider cable with 8 connections. Otherwise its very easy to setup, has a decent picture and works just like it is advertised. Costs a fraction of what internet cameras cost. A DLINK 5020L sells for around $120. These cameras are $17 each on AMAZON. Both have night vision and digital zoom. The 5020 pans and tilts. Thats significant but if don’t need pan and tilt the price difference is incredible.

Buy These Cameras – From the packaging to the night vision, this kit is awesome! Everything comes well organized and individually wrapped inside a nice cardboard box like the kind you get with higher end new laptops. I installed the cameras on all 4 corners of my park model home using the included drill guides and some nuts and bolts I got from the hardware store. The included screws and anchors would have worked fine but we get some strong winds here in the south west. I wanted to go overkill and make sure the cameras didn’t come down if something got snagged on them.
